[unable to retrieve full-text content]Free America Network Articles
Flash flooding strikes Texas, while Hurricane Humberto moves away from US
Wed Sep 18 , 2019
Imelda made landfall yesterday in Freeport, Texas, as a minimal tropical storm with winds of 40 mph. No longer a tropical storm as of Wednesday, the system is just a heavy rainmaker — call it remnants of Imelda. The highest rainfall total so far was in Turkey Creek, Texas, just […]
